Straight Creek Trail

NATIONAL FOREST TRAIL | Huson

Straight Creek Trail (99) takes you up to the State Line Divide Trail on the Idaho/Montana divide. It follows the creek and features Old Growth Forests. Closed to motorized vehicles. This trail fords Straight Creek several times.

Length: 10.0 miles

Trail Begins: Junction with Trail 103, North Fork of West Fork Fish Creek

Trail Ends: Junction with trails 510 and 114 at Chilcoot Pass

Area Map: Lolo Forest Visitors Map

USGS Map1: Straight Peak

Township 13N; Range 26W; Section 1

  • From I-90, travel west from Missoula to Exit 66, Fish Creek Road. Follow Fish Creek Road 343 south approximately 9 miles, turn west on 7750, and follow this new road for approximately 7 miles to Clearwater Crossing Campground. Hike 0.5 mile northwest on North Fork Fish Creek Trail 103 to Junction of Straight Creek Trail 99.
